Is the Jungle Cup suitable for hot and cold drinks?
Yes! It can be used for cold and hot drinks from 0 to 80 degrees Celsius.

Can I have my own logo printed on the Jungle Cup?
Yes, this is possible. At the moment the minimum order quantity for a custom print is 100.000 units. You can use 4 colours for your artwork which is printed on the cup by litho printing. You can't print the inside or bottom of our cups.

What about the Single Use Plastic Directive?

Many EU member states have confirmed that all cups using a water dispersion coating must bear the plastic in product logo.  This is because the available tests cannot test down to 0.0000%. There is therefore the expectation that there is plastic present in industry standard water dispersion coatings.  Jungle Cup does not use an industry standard water dispersion coating. However, until we can find a test to prove there is 0.0000% plastic in our cups, the recommendation is to bear the SUPd logo. It is still the most sustainable paper disposable cup!
